Abstract
Research was conducted at the Ag Engineering and Agronomy Farm and the ISU Dairy Farm Complex in the fall of 2009. The research equipment, a John Deere 9860 STS combine and an AGCO 4790 large square baler, were prepared in the Ag Engineering/Agronomy (AEA) Farm shop with updated biomass processing attachments and a hitch that would allow for the baler to be pulled behind the combine during field operations. Initial testing was carried out on the Marsden Farm in an area designated for the Advance Machinery Group.
